Antipop Consortium
 
Are an incredible hip-hop outfit who showcase not only fluid raps,
brilliant rhymes and impeccable delivery, but also production that
defines any sort of categorization--elements of musique concrete,
turntablism, trademark hip-hop, glitch, and subdued elements of
noise and drone. Their last album before they disbanded in 2005
was a collaboration with Matthew Shipp, an avant-garde pianist
in the vein of Cecil Taylor, so their music could just as easily go
in the "experimental" thread. My personal favorite is Arrhythmia
(which is in the shoutbox) which sounds like a mix of Aesop,
RJD2 and Black Dice.
